Hayes to Head New York Liquidation Bureau
Dennis J. Hayes has been appointed special deputy superintendent of the New York Liquidation Bureau (NYLB).
Hayes has been a senior executive at NYLB since 1996, most recently serving as assistant special deputy superintendent.
As special deputy superintendent, Hayes will head the NYLB, reporting to Acting Superintendent James J. Wrynn.
The NYLB works to rehabilitate financially impaired insurers and carry out an orderly liquidation of insolvent companies.
He replaces Mark Peters, who served as head of the NYLB since April 2007.
